The Buttertones are a Los Angeles-based cult rock band. The group has built a loyal fan base
via their atmospheric live shows and cinematic catalog. From 2017’s Gravedigging, 2018’s
Midnight In A Moonless Dream, 2020’s Jazzhound, and 2024’s Face to Face With Fantasy, the
band has left lasting impressions at Coachella, Tropicalia, When We Were Young, and beyond.
The group consists of members Richard Araiza (vocals/guitar), Modesto Cobian (lead guitar),
Mimi Nissan (keys/guitar/bg vocals), Karly Low (bass/bg vocals), Carlos Sanchez (tenor sax),
and Brandon Galindo (drums/bg vocals)
Unapologetically blurring the lines between pop and indie surf rock, The Hayds, led by frontman Joshua Muñoz, with lead guitarist Darius Rodriguez, bassist Christian Martinez, and drummer Christian Daniel, continually expand their sonically diverse, yet emotionally cohesive discography. With eye-catching showmanship and raw, cinematic songwriting, the four-piece brings edge and electricity to every performance.
The Sols are a San Diego-based Chicano indie rock band blending surfy guitars, infectious hooks, and bilingual lyricism for a cultural resonance that bridges nostalgia and modern alternative. Since 2022, they’ve built a loyal following with catchy singles like “Crumb Queen” and “NYSAD,” reflecting their heritage while energizing Southern California’s music scene.
